Europe getting Hazed May 23

Free Radical's PS3-exclusive first-person shooter has been given a precise target in the UK and EU; NA release date still foggy.

In February, Haze was slated for May, but gamers were perhaps loathe to actually believe it, since the game had originally been planned for a release in the first half of 2007. The release date was then shifted to sometime before the end of March this year, and then put back further, to autumn.

Now Free Radical Design's first-person shooter for the PlayStation 3 has been given its (hopefully) final release window in the UK and the rest of Europe. Today, Ubisoft announced the PS3 exclusive will ship on both sides of the English Channel on May 23. The sci-fi shooter still remains without an official North American launch date, although online retailers are listing it as hitting stores on May 20.

The Haze date sets up an interesting battle. Yesterday, Electronic Arts announced that Rock Band would be coming to European shores as an Xbox 360 timed exclusive on the same day (albeit at a price of about £180 once peripherals are included).

Haze is set in the not too distant future, where governments have been outsourcing their military operations to private military corporations (PMCs). One PMC, Mantel Industries, has its troops dosed up on a drug called Nectar, which gives them heightened senses, reflexes, and strength.
